Wine Tasting

What's the process of serving and tasting wine?

Serving and tasting wine involves a mix of tradition and technique that enhances the overall expertise. Here’s a short overview of the strategy:


Serving Wine

Before pouring the wine, it’s important to choose on the best glass. Generally, red wines profit from a bigger, bowl-shaped glass to permit for aeration, whereas white wines are finest served in narrower glasses to preserve their crispness.

Pour the wine gently into the glass, filling it no more than one-third full to permit room for swirling and aromas to concentrate.


Tasting Wine

To correctly style wine, follow these steps:



Look: Examine the colour and readability of the wine. Tilt the glass to watch the hue towards a white background.
Swirl: Gently swirl the wine within the glass to aerate it, which helps launch its aromas.
Smell: Take a moment to inhale the aromas deeply. Try to establish different scents, corresponding to fruit, spice, or oak.

Finally, contemplate the overall expertise, including any emotions or reminiscences the wine evokes. This multi-sensory journey permits for a deeper appreciation of each distinctive bottle.


What is a wine tasting person called?

A person who participates in wine tasting is also identified as a wine enthusiast or a wine taster. Additionally, there are particular titles that might be used depending on their stage of expertise:

Oenologist: A scientist who specializes in the research of wine and winemaking.
Winemaker: A one that is directly involved within the production of wine.



Each of these titles reflects completely different ranges of expertise and involvement on the earth of wine.


Do you eat during a wine tasting?

Yes, it's common to have snacks or mild foods during a wine tasting. Eating might help cleanse your palate between tastings and enhance your general experience. Cheese, crackers, and fruits are in style options as they pair properly with numerous wines and can spotlight different flavor profiles.
